去年夏天,我在咖啡馆里,看着电脑屏幕上“无法建立http链接”的提示,心里一阵烦躁。那是个周末,我正在赶一篇关于新技术的文章,时间紧迫。我试了又试,刷新网页,重启路由器,甚至还怀疑是不是家里的猫猫调皮把网线咬断了。
等等,还有个事,我突然想到,我记得之前有一次,同样的情况,是因为浏览器缓存出了问题。我打开浏览器的设置,清除缓存,奇迹发生了,网页终于顺利加载。那一刻,我深深地吸了口气,心里暗自庆幸,还好不是更复杂的技术问题。
但这也让我想起,无论是工作还是生活,遇到困难时,有时候不是问题本身有多难,而是我们解决它的方式。比如,这次我如果只是简单地重启电脑,或许也能解决问题,但那种解决问题的成就感,是重启无法带来的。所以,下次再遇到类似的问题,我可能会先尝试清除缓存,毕竟,有时候,答案就在我们不经意的角落里。
无法建立http链接这事复杂在可能是网络配置问题。先说最重要的,检查你的网络连接是否稳定,比如去年我们跑的那个项目,当时就是因为网络波动导致无法建立连接,大概3000量级的数据传输就因为这一小点问题停滞了。另外一点,确保你的设备支持http协议,有些老旧设备可能不支持最新的http/2版本。还有个细节挺关键的,有时候防火墙设置也会阻止http连接,我一开始也以为只是网络问题,后来发现不对,得检查防火墙设置。
等等,还有个事,有时候浏览器缓存问题也会导致无法连接,你可以尝试清除浏览器缓存重试。最后提醒一个容易踩的坑,就是检查你的域名解析是否正确,有时候DNS解析错误也会导致无法连接到http服务。我觉得值得试试调整DNS设置,或者更换DNS服务器。
这就是坑,别信免费代理,2023年5月,我客户就因此损失了5万。
确保网络连接稳定,别用老旧浏览器,2022年12月,有人因此误操作导致数据丢失。
检查防火墙设置,别忽略SSL证书,2021年8月,一个企业因此业务中断24小时。